Provenance

Where it came from

Bazaar Trader was released in 2010 as part of the Worldwake set, the second expansion in the Zendikar block. The set focused on the theme of exploration and land-based mechanics, and this card was designed as a niche utility creature. Its unique ability to permanently trade control of permanents between players was created to offer players a creative, if mechanically complex, way to manipulate the board state, particularly in multiplayer formats like Commander.

The card was illustrated by Matt Cavotta, who sought to capture the eccentric and nomadic aesthetic typical of the plane of Zendikar. Cavotta’s artwork depicts a weathered, opportunistic merchant, perfectly reflecting the card's mechanical identity as a shrewd dealer. Upon its release, it was received as a flavorful, albeit high-variance, rare that challenged players to find unconventional interactions rather than relying on standard competitive strategies.
